What is a Full Solar Power System for Your Home?

A full solar power system for home (often called a solar-plus-storage system) goes far beyond simple solar panels. It's an integrated setup designed to capture, store, manage, and utilize solar energy to maximize self-consumption and provide backup power. The core goal is energy independence: using your own generated solar power day and night, during grid outages, and while optimizing for financial returns. Key Components of a Complete Home Solar Solution

Think of your full system as a team where every player has a critical role. Here’s the lineup:

  • Solar Panels (The Generators): These photovoltaic modules on your roof convert sunlight into direct current (DC) electricity.
  • Inverter(s) (The Brain & Interpreter): This crucial device converts the DC electricity from your panels into the alternating current (AC) that your home appliances use. Modern systems often use a combination of a central inverter and module-level power electronics (MLPEs) for optimal performance.
  • Battery Storage System (The Energy Bank): This is the game-changer. Instead of sending excess solar energy back to the grid for a small credit, you store it in a home battery. This stored energy powers your home after sunset, during peak rate periods, or during a blackout.
  • Energy Management System (EMS) (The Conductor): The intelligent software that orchestrates the entire flow. It decides when to charge the battery, power the home, or export to the grid based on your usage patterns, electricity rates, and weather forecasts.
  • Balancing of System (BoS): This includes mounting hardware, wiring, switches, and safety equipment—the unsung heroes that ensure a safe, durable installation.

Beyond Bill Savings: The Tangible Benefits

The financial return is compelling, but the true value of a full solar power system for home is multifaceted. The phenomenon of rising energy costs and increasing grid instability is met with the powerful data point: a home with solar-plus-storage can achieve 70-90% energy self-sufficiency. Let's break down the benefits:

  • Resilience & Peace of Mind: Power outages, whether from storms or grid overload, become a minor inconvenience. Your essential loads—refrigeration, lights, internet, medical equipment—stay on seamlessly.
  • Peak Shaving: In regions with Time-of-Use (TOU) rates, your system can avoid drawing expensive grid power during peak evening hours by using stored solar energy, dramatically cutting your bill.
  • Increased Self-Consumption: With storage, you can use more of the solar energy you produce, which is increasingly valuable as net metering policies evolve in many US states and European countries.
  • Enhanced Sustainability: You're not just using cleaner energy; you're using it more efficiently and reducing strain on the public grid.
